Output 3d5ee81ecaa6f364948f7a830faf35f14e2b92ea2903c745b388e83db11e8ed4:21

value
3950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e853e980b19b6845c6eaa0b012e9a46ff39abd OP_EQUAL
address
AC2barkz69pRuZCZgpSdpEHfVfdKETEAgR
transaction
3d5ee81ecaa6f364948f7a830faf35f14e2b92ea2903c745b388e83db11e8ed4